Just took my Td5 for a spin, 5th gear at 80kph is 2050rpm, 5th at 90kph is 2350rpm and 5th at 100kph is 2600rpm.. All give and take a little bit of course the tacho in it is an 8000rpm rev range one which I find annoying to read, who needs all that in a diesel!!
And Td5's do have a bit of a hum, you do get used to it but it seems like it's revving like crazy at first!
